Mary Ellen Beatty was born in 1937 in Kelleys Island, Erie County, Ohio, United States of America, the child of Henry Theodore Henny Beatty And Rosella B Rose Elfers. In 1960, Mary Ellen Beatty resided in Sandusky. Mary Ellen Beatty married Donald John Huntley, and had children including Donald James Huntley, Ellen Marie Huntley. Mary Ellen Beatty passed away in 2015 in Kelleys Island, Erie County, Ohio, United States of America.
